Two Factor Authentication
A few months ago, Nicole got impersonated on Facebook. Her friends kept emailing her ‘you got hacked’ but she knew better… because she had two factor authentication on for Facebook. And her email.
Two factor authentication means just that. After putting in a username/password, a code gets texted to your cell phone for you to type into the website to finish logging in. You can register specific computers/cell phones so you are not having to do this all the time but it’s excellent protection. (Your bank has been using it for years.)
While we all dragged our feet about doing it for the perceived hassle, it’s really not as bad as we thought. Here’s a how-to article for the more popular sites that use it: http://www.cnet.com/uk/how-to/how-to-enable-two-factor-authentication-on-popular-sites/
Do you need an SSL? A secure certificate is a tool that essentially encrypts your website pages. If you are collecting, say, payment information from your customers, the pages asking for this sensitive info need to be secure. (You’ll see https in your address bar when this is happening.)
If you don’t know much about secure certificates besides what I just wrote above, Woothemes has an excellent FAQ about them that's not totally hard to understand: https://docs.woothemes.com/document/ssl-faq/
